Description
MK64FX512VLQ12            Description     K64 product family members are optimized for cost-sensitive applications that require low power consumption, USB/ Ethernet connectivity, and up to 256 KB embedded SRAM. These devices have the full support and scalability of the Kinetis series. The product provides: running power consumption as low as 250MHzA/ μ. The static power consumption is reduced to 5.80 μ A, full state holding and 5 μ wake-up. The lowest static mode is as low as 339 nA ·USB LS/FS OTG 2.0.It supports embedded 3.3V and 120mA LDO VREG, supports 10 Mbit/s 100 Mbit/s Ethernet MAC without crystal operation for USB devices, and supports MII and RMII interfaces.  
The manufacturer of this component is NXP USA Inc. It is a type of microcontroller chip designed for embedded systems, specifically in the category of embedded microcontrollers. The package or case for this chip is 144-LQFP, and it belongs to the Kinetis K60 series. It has a total of 144 terminations, and the peak reflow temperature for this chip is 260 degrees Celsius. The terminal pitch, or distance between each terminal, is 0.5mm. This chip falls under the category of microcontroller, RISC, and has a 32-bit core size. It also includes a data converter with A/D (analog-to-digital) capabilities of 41x16 bits and D/A (digital-to-analog) capabilities of 2x12 bits. Additionally, this chip has YES for DAC (digital-to-analog converter) channels and an EEPROM (electrically erasable programmable read-only memory) size of 4K x 8.
Performance ? Up to 120 MHz ARM? Cortex?-M4 core with DSP instructions and floating point unit Memories and memory interfaces ? Up to 1 MB program flash memory and 256 KB RAM ? Upto 128 KB FlexNVM and 4 KB FlexRAM on devices with FlexMemory ? FlexBus external bus interface System peripherals ? Multiple low-power modes, low-leakage wake-up unit ? Memory protection unit with multi-master protection ? 16-channel DMA controller ? External watchdog monitor and software watchdog Security and integrity modules ? Hardware CRC module ? Hardware random-number generator ? Hardware encryption supporting DES, 3DES, AES, MD5, SHA-1, and SHA-256 algorithms ? 128-bit unique identification (ID) number per chip Analog modules ? Two 16-bit SAR ADCs ? Two 12-bit DACs ? Three analog comparators (CMP) ? Voltage reference
